Study Load

Students are to register in the College online or through the Registration Office according to the following:

  • Full-Time Students (Private University Council (PUC) Scholarship or Private Students) are required to take a minimum of 12 credits per semester, unless it is their last semester.
  • Special-Needs Students (PUC Scholarship or Private Students) are required to take a minimum of 9 credits per semester, unless it is their last semester.
  • Part-Time Private Students are required to take a minimum of 6 credits per semester, unless it is their last semester or have received approval from the Vice President of Academic Affairs.
  • Students are permitted to enroll in a maximum of 18 credit hours only per semester. Students may enroll in more than 18 credit hours but less than 21 credits after receiving approval from the Vice President of Academic Affairs.
  • Students on probation are permitted to enroll in a maximum of 12 credit hours unless they receive approval from the Vice President of Academic Affairs.
  • Students receiving internal or external scholarships, stipends, assistantships or other payments toward education expenses are handled according to the sponsored regulations in installment payment.

Time Frame

  • All degree-seeking students are required to consult an academic advisor prior to their initial registration in any regular semester. At the conclusion of the student’s advising session, the advisor will issue the advising authorization electronically.
  • Full-time students are required to graduate within seven semesters from the day of admission. An exception for additional semesters may be given with the approval of the President.
  • Part-Time Students are required to graduate within eight semesters from the day of admission. An exception for additional semesters may be given with the approval of the President.
